| Metric | WFC | UBS |
|---|---|---|
| Market cap | $265.96 B | $173.29 B |
| US-listed rank | #56 | #89 |
| Revenue (latest FY) | $83.70B | - |
| Net income (latest FY) | $21.34B | - |
| Net margin | 25.5% | - |
| P/E (trailing FY) | 12.5x | - |
| SEC filings | 942 | 785 |
